Understanding Biosimilars and Regulatory Frameworks

Before delving into the specifics of documentation requirements, it is critical to understand what constitutes a biosimilar. A biosimilar is a biologic product that is highly similar to an already approved reference biologic product. The key differences lie in the acceptable minor variations in clinically inactive components and potential differences in clinically relevant properties.

The regulatory frameworks governing biosimilars in the U.S. and EU share similarities but also reflect distinct nuances. Step 1: Gathering Required Documentation

The initial step in developing a submission for a biosimilar involves gathering the necessary documentation to substantiate its safety, efficacy, and quality. This foundational work typically includes:

  • Comprehensive Quality Information: This includes analytical characterization, manufacturing information, and details on the control strategy. It should provide extensive information on the quality attributes of the biosimilar compared to the reference product.
  • Non-Clinical Studies: Both pharmacodynamics and toxicology studies may be required to demonstrate similarity to the reference product.
  • Clinical Studies: The key clinical studies rely on comparative clinical efficacy and safety data between the biosimilar and the reference product.

It is essential to consult both the FDA and EMA guidance documents to ensure that all required information is adequately included. The FDA has provided specific guidance on biosimilar submissions, while the EMA offers detailed recommendations that can be navigated through their official website.

Step 2: Implementing CTD Structure in Documentation

The Common Technical Document (CTD) is the established format for regulatory submissions in both the U.S. and EU. While the structure may appear uniformly stringent, there are critical distinctions that must be observed during the preparation of content.

Here’s a closer look at the CTD structure:

  • Module 1: Administrative information and prescribing information for dossiers submitted in the U.S. must follow specific FDA guidelines while EU submissions must adhere to EMA requirements.
  • Module 2: This includes summaries of quality, non-clinical, and clinical information. Each aspect should be cross-referenced against the reference product to elucidate any differences and similarities.
  • Module 3: Detailed information on quality should include comprehensive descriptions of manufacturing processes and their control and a comparability exercise comparing your biosimilar to the reference product.
  • Module 4 and 5: Non-clinical and clinical study reports can include pivotal trials performed to demonstrate similarity.

Adhering to the CTD structure not only ensures regulatory compliance but enhances clarity, making it easier for reviewers to evaluate evidence effectively.

Step 3: Writing Regulatory Submissions with Clarity and Precision

An essential aspect of regulatory writing is clarity. The documentation must communicate clearly and effectively; ambiguous language can delay approvals or even lead to rejection. The following tips can improve the quality of your regulatory submissions:

  • Tailor Language to Audience: Ensure that terminology is appropriately selected for the audience while maintaining scientific accuracy. Avoid jargon that may mislead or confuse regulatory personnel.
  • Use Clear Formatting: Effective use of headings, bullet points, and tables can significantly enhance readability. For instance, utilizing comparative tables helps convey data succinctly.
  • Consistency is Key: Make sure that headings and terminology remain consistent throughout the document. Discrepancies can detract from your submission’s professionalism and coherence.

Step 5: Post-Submission Activities and Communication with Regulatory Authorities

Once submissions are made, proactively engaging with regulatory authorities is beneficial. Maintaining open lines of communication can facilitate addressing potential inquiries or issues that arise during the review process.

Here are a few strategies to enhance communication:

  • Engage in Early Dialogue: Consider pre-submission meetings with the FDA or EMA to discuss your intended approach. This will provide an opportunity to receive critical feedback on your scientific rationale and proposed clinical trial design.
  • Respond Promptly to Inquiries: Be prepared to provide additional information promptly if the regulatory authorities request clarifications or additional data.
  • Monitor Evolving Guidelines: Regulatory expectations might evolve over time. Regularly review current guidance documents from FDA, EMA, and other agencies to stay informed on potential changes affecting biosimilar submissions.

Regular interaction and information sharing with authorities can enhance mutual understanding and improve the chances of a successful review process.
